Bandicut significantly lowers the quality of my videos now

Hi there. I wasn't sure where else to post this, so I'm sorry if this isn't the right place.

I've used the free trials of Bandicam and Bandicut for over a year now. I have no problem with the watermark, and honestly I've had no problems with the service, until very recently. I accidentally deleted a great video I made a few months ago, but it was very easy for me to remake with Bandicam. However, when I try to merge the clips together, no matter what I do, Bandicut makes it such horrendously blurry quality now. When I previously made the video, it had a very crisp quality to it, and I didn't even do much to edit it. But now, everything I do causes the video to become blurry and pixelated.
How did this happen? Did Bandicut have some kind of update which severely limits the quality of videos in the free trial? I've found a couple other services which easily give my video higher quality, but they always trim a second off of my clips, which is mildly irritating.

Hello,

With [High-Speed mode], you can quickly cut/merge videos without converting (encoding) them and without decreasing the quality.

If it is a file that cannot be edited in high-speed mode, you can increase the quality by setting the video size to the original and adjusting the quality to 80~100 in encoding mode.

Please refer to parts 4 and 5 in the image below.
